We are part of the Panda Recycling Group and a leading waste management company in West Yorkshire, providing integrated collection and recycling services to a wide range of businesses and local authorities.
We are seeking a skilled Fabricator–Welder to join our Fabrications team in Leeds. The successful candidate will be responsible for repairing, maintaining, and refurbishing waste containers to a high standard, ensuring all work reflects the quality and professionalism expected by our customers.
Key Responsibilities
- Carry out welding, grinding, cutting, burning, and general fabrication duties as assigned by the Fabrications/Maintenance Manager.
- Repair and maintain waste containers, ensuring they are fully functional, safe, and presentable for customer use.
- Maintain machinery, tools, and equipment to a high standard, promptly reporting defects.
- Work collaboratively with the welding/fabrication team and approved third-party contractors.
- Ensure all work areas are free from hazards prior to commencing tasks.
- Maintain good housekeeping standards within the fabrication yard at all times.
- Support the maintenance workshop with tasks as required.
- Clean down your work area at the end of each shift and ensure safe working practices are followed.
- Complete and submit relevant documentation such as log sheets, tool checks, inspection reports, and other required paperwork.
- Communicate professionally with customers, colleagues, and site personnel while representing the company.
- Comply with all company Health & Safety policies, procedures, and safe systems of work.
- Ensure correct use of PPE at all times.
- Carry out hot works in accordance with HSE guidelines and company permit-to-work procedures.
- Immediately report any hazards, unsafe conditions, near misses or incidents to the Fabrications Manager.
- Participate in SHEQ workshop tours.
Essential Qualifications & Experience
- NVQ Level 2 or Level 3 in Fabrication & Welding (or equivalent).
- Proven experience in MIG welding (additional welding processes beneficial).
- Ability to read and understand technical drawings.
- Experience using grinders, cutting equipment, and general fabrication tools.
- Good understanding of workshop Health & Safety practices.
- Full UK driving licence (if operationally required).
Desirable
- BS EN ISO 9606-1 (Welding Qualification) or equivalent coding/certification.
- IPAF or PASMA certification for working at height.
- Forklift Truck (FLT) licence (counterbalance or telehandler).
- Experience working in waste, recycling, manufacturing, or heavy-duty engineering environments.
- Hot Works & Fire Safety awareness training.
- First Aid at Work certification.
